Variety MS-60 MS-62 MS-63 MS-64 MS-65 MS-66 MS-67
2012 - Magnetic $0.05$0.10$0.35$4.90$14.00$22.30$45.70
2012 - Non magnetic $0.05$0.10$0.35$4.90$13.70$28.10$54.90

Mint state defines business strike coins that barely or never has been in circulation.

Varieties and features

1 cent 2012 - Magnetic

The coin does stick to a magnet.

  • Mintage:
    • Circulation: 111,375,000
  • Alloy and composition: Copper-plated steel (94% steel, 4.5% copper, 1.5 % nickel)
  • Magnetism: Magnetic
  • Weight: 2.35 g
  • Diameter: 19.05 mm
  • Thickness: 1.5 mm
  • Edge: Plain (smooth)
  • Axis (orientation): ↑↑ (medal alignment)
  • Minted by: Royal Canadian Mint
  • Finish(es) (types):
    • Circulation
    • Uncirculated
    • Specimen
  • Legend (lettering):
    • Obverse: ELIZABETH II D • G • REGINA
    • Reverse: 1 CENT 2012 CANADA
  • Design(s):
    • Obverse: Uncrowned bust of Elizabeth II.
    • Reverse: Two maple leaves on the same twig.
  • Designer(s):
    • Obverse: Susanna Blunt
    • Reverse: G. E. Kruger-Gray

1 cent 2012 - Non magnetic

The coin does not stick to a magnet.

  • Mintage:
    • Circulation: 87,972,000
  • Alloy and composition: Copper-plated zinc
  • Magnetism: Non-magnetic
  • Weight: 2.25 g
  • Diameter: 19.05 mm
  • Thickness: 1.5 mm
  • Edge: Plain (smooth)
  • Axis (orientation): ↑↑ (medal alignment)
  • Minted by: Royal Canadian Mint
  • Finish(es) (types):
    • Circulation
    • Uncirculated
    • Proof
  • Legend (lettering):
    • Obverse: ELIZABETH II D • G • REGINA
    • Reverse: 1 CENT 2012 CANADA
  • Design(s):
    • Obverse: Uncrowned bust of Elizabeth II.
    • Reverse: Two maple leaves on the same twig.
  • Designer(s):
    • Obverse: Susanna Blunt
    • Reverse: G. E. Kruger-Gray
